The AMHT is based at Homerton Row Site and provides assessment and treatment to City & Hackney Adolescents presenting with psychosis and severe mental illness, and those requiring more intensive support for serious mental health difficulties associated with risk to self. The role of the consultant is to provide psychiatric assessment and treatment where appropriate, contribute a psychiatric perspective, provide senior clinical leadership to the multidisciplinary team, offer consultation to other professionals and agencies and facilitate the development of the team and wider service.

The team, is clinically led by the CTL and the consultant psychiatrist together with an 8b clinician. It is a small cohesive team comprising of clinical psychology, family therapy, nursing, CAMHS Practitioner and an OT who has a joint role leading on internal duty system, as well as a Specialist Registrar from the GOSH/RLH rotation and an F2 doctor from HUH.

The Team caseload is around 45 - 50 cases including approximately 10 Early Intervention for Psychosis young people.

The team model includes joint working between Psychiatry and allocated care-coordinator as well as individual working with young people and their families to provide developmentally informed evidence-based treatments. The consultant will have a small caseload of around 15 patients as well as providing psychiatric assessments of other young people as required.

Liaison with Tier 4 inpatient services, CAMHS extended crisis service (CECS) and the developing Home Treatment Team (HTT) is a key expectation of the role, as are relationships with the Homerton Hospital, and Childrens Social Care. The AMHT plays a key role in the service with consultation to other pathways and timely intervention for high risk young people requiring more intensive care.

The post holder will also be expected to see on average one new routine assessment per week in the assessment clinic.
